Written in the Stars is a charming, queer rom-com featuring a quirky social media astrologer and a grumpy actuary who enter a fake dating arrangement to appease their families.
I’m giving this four stars because while the story was adorable and fun, Elle’s reason for agreeing to the fake dating setup felt a little weak. Plus, Elle and Darcy are such polar opposites that at times, I struggled to fully believe in their chemistry.
That said, as the story unfolded, I couldn’t help but fall for these characters. I laughed, I teared up, and by the end, I was completely rooting for them. I can’t wait to read the rest of this trilogy!

Oof, this one was tough. I liked Darcy as a character generally but that’s about all I liked. None of the plot points felt justified, the spice/instalust was kind of cringey, and the brother was deeply unlikable to me as someone who can appreciate a good boundary. I appreciated Darcy standing up for Elle to Elle’s family, but otherwise the rest of this book was kind of a mess.
Extra note: other than a scene early on where Elle overhears Darcy criticizing her to a friend, I didn’t see that this had much resemblance to Pride and Prejudice at all, and I’m mystified that it’s marketed as such.
